-
Notifications
You must be signed in to change notification settings - Fork 895
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
cellmatch: New pass for picking out standard cells automatically #4300
Conversation
povik
commented
Mar 27, 2024
•
edited
Loading
edited
You're a machine @povik! |
This is useful for writing low-level structural Verilog with some degree of portability between cell libraries. Say you write a Kogge-Stone carry lookahead unit out of
You can map to those cells with the following script (here taking a SKY130 target as an example):
|
@QuantamHD Hah, you are quick to notice the PR. :)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This could use comb cell eval instead of limiting itself to AIGs, no?
I think this is super cool, and really helpful to users! Thanks for working on it |
Yes, but I leave dealing with the eval API for another day... |
I made this change, also I updated the quoted help message above to what it is now. |
Please review and consider pulling in my comments |